Description

Advances in Metal Additive Manufacturing explains fundamental information and the latest research on new technologies, including powder bed fusion, direct energy deposition using high energy beams, and hybrid additive and subtractive methods. This book introduces readers to the technology, provides everything needed to understand how the different stages work together, and inspires to think beyond traditional metal processing to capture new ideas in metal. Chapters offer an introduction on metal additive manufacturing, processes, and properties and standards and then present surveys on the most significant international advances in metal additive manufacturing.
Throughout, the book presents a focus on the effect of important process parameters on the microstructure, mechanical properties and wear behavior of additively manufactured parts. Covers the entire process chain of metal additive manufacturing, from input data preparation to part certification Describes a wide range of the latest design tools and options, including generative design, topology optimization, and lattice and surface optimization Addresses additive manufacturing, with a comprehensive list of metals including titanium, aluminum, iron-and nickel-based alloys and Inconel 718
